How to Get to Super Junior Yesung’s Mouse Rabbit Cafe, Seoul

That said, it is really easy to get to Mouse Rabbit Cafe. Take Line 2 to Konkuk University Station (Kondae) and get out at Exit 2. After you get down the flight of stairs, turn left and walk straight until you see a Gongcha outlet. There should be an alley with a Samsung outlet beside it. Turn left and viola, you’re there. Seoul Adventure: Trick Eye Museum and How To Get There

If you didn’t know, there is a museum in Seoul called “Trick Eye Museum”. It’s pretty cool actually. Inside this museum, there are basically paintings which depending on the angle which you take the photo, it actually creates a illusion of you being part of the painting.
